Water Service Completely Restored

The City of Napa has completely restored water service to the City of Napa, and no further precautions are needed. The water has been tested. There were over 150 water main breaks as a result of the #NapaQuake.  Nixle announcement here.

Earthquake Local Assistance Center opens Monday, September 8

The City of Napa and Napa County will open a Local Assistance Center (LAC) at 1:00 pm, on Monday, September 8, 2014 at the old JV Liquor Store at 301 First Street in Napa, 707-258-7829. The web address is www.napaquakeinfo.com.

Confirmed participants include:

  • American Red Cross
  • City of Napa Building Department
  • Napa County Planning Building & Environmental Services
  • Napa County Assessor
  • Napa County Health and Human Services Agencies: Self Sufficiency, Mental Health and Public Health
  • State of California: Department of Insurance, Housing and Community Development
  • Franchise Tax Board
  • Board of Equalization
  • Contractors State License Board
  • Legal Aid
  • Season of Sharing
  • Tzu Chi Foundation
